Smart Phone Flash Tool (SP Flash Tool) is the primary software used to unbrick or upgrade MT6577 devices.

Using the wrong scatter file is a recipe for disaster, as it can lead to partition overlaps, boot loops, or a completely dead device. Therefore, you must obtain the file specifically designed for your exact device model and firmware version. Common Partitions in MT6577 Devices Smart Phone Flash
